Pico Park is one of the most unusual co-op games ever released. Supporting up to ten players in a single game, this puzzle title lets players work together as a larger group to try and find a key that will allow them to unlock the door at the end of the stage, permitting them to move on.
Pico Park comes with a huge variety of levels and game modes, making it a great party game for larger groups to play. The standard world mode comes with 48 different levels split into 12 different styles, while players can also play together locally or in battle/endless modes.

Although there are a lot of survival games and zombie survival games, few allow so many players to come together and work to loot, build, and survive. Project Zomboid is special for this, and players have been hugely enjoying the isometric open-world aspect. Not just this, but also the many different elements of survival within this game, and, of course, the co-op aspect.
Being able to work alongside so many friends to try and survive the onslaught makes for a charming but dangerous time. Players get to live the simple life at times, crafting and fishing, and other times they have to grab loot where they can in deadly areas and try to take on hordes of zombies. The blend of simple base-building and tension-filled moments makes for a great experience alongside large groups of friends.

One of the best party games for a group of gamers ever seen, Human Fall Flat is a physics platformer that can be played by up to eight people online. It encourages players to work together to try and navigate puzzles and levels, many of which can be solved in a variety of different ways.
The fun in Human Fall Flat is the completely ridiculous physics and the openness of the levels, allowing players to find their own solutions creatively. Working together in a larger group makes the game even more fun, making this a perfect single-evening experience for a party of six.

Now, here is a co-op game that is not for the faint of heart. Barotrauma tasks your crew with managing a submarine, with each person being assigned a role that comes with specialized assignments. Depending on the chosen mode, you might have a specific goal like finding the Eye of Europe or be able to just explore without any specific objectives. Either way, you will likely be in for a tough time, as the game demands that everybody pulls their weight, and failure to do so transforms that person into an anchor.
Although supporting up to 16 players, Barotrauma has a wide range of submarines that are designed around different group sizes, with the intermediate ones being suitable for 6 players. In fact, the game has 6 roles, so this group size is pretty much perfect. If you have fewer players, some people will have to take on multiple roles, which can actually make things easier as playthroughs tend to get harder as you expand your crew.

Another game that allows a large group of players to enter a single world, Terraria has often been cited as having similarities to Minecraft, but in two dimensions. There are a lot of things that make Terraria unique, though, including the intricacy of the crafting system.
This can be an overwhelming game to get into initially, but with a few friends along for the ride, Terraria is much easier to get to grips with quickly. As of version 1.4, up to 16 players can join a single server, making this a perfect cooperative experience with a lot of replayability for six players or more.

Tribes of Midgard is somewhat polarizing, but it warrants a mention as it can really hit the mark with certain groups. An action RPG that also focuses on survival and crafting, the game features two modes: Saga and Survival. The latter challenges you to survive for as long as possible, which is not actually all that difficult; meanwhile, the former revolves around beating a boss before an endless night falls that makes it impossible to leave your base. Both modes allow for standalone runs, and they are fairly different from each other.
Although the gameplay loop can get repetitive, Tribes of Midgard works way better in co-op than solo. The game has 10 classes, so everyone can pick one that suits their gameplay style. Although billed as an action RPG, Tribes of Midgard facilitates other playstyles as well, so not everyone in the party has to focus on hacking and slashing their way through a campaign.
